  1. Allen, do you know what process WheelTech used in duplicating the "look" of the wheel?

    Although the WheelTech guys were happy to talk about it at the time, it's been long enough ago that I don't remember. I don't recall anything at all about the prep process. Judging by what's visible inside, I think the finish itself looks like a few layers of differing metallic lacquers with one or more layers of urethane clearcoat.

    I was concerned that the finish wouldn't be scratch resistant, but that's never been a problem. It seems similar to the original in that respect.
